Elizabeth george speare 19081994, born and raised in melrose, massachusetts, earned bachelors and masters degrees at boston university, taught high school, married, and raised two children before beginning her career as a writer. Elizabeth george speare 19081994 won the 1959 newbery medal for the witch of blackbird pond, and the 1962 newbery medal for the bronze bow. Daniel grows up suffering immense hardship at the hands of the romans. After witnessing his fathers crucifixion by roman soldiers, daniel bar jamin yearns for vengeance.

Elizabeth george speare when the romans brutally kill daniel bar jamins father, the young palestinian searches for a leader to drive them out, but comes to realize that love may be a more powerful weapon than hate.
